Riege: Late ice fishing is the best | Austin Daily Herald: "As winter ice fishing progresses some tactics have to be changed. Early in the season the action is fast and as the ice gets thicker and the days colder the fish have a tendency to slow down and move. In fact, in most bodies of water mobility is crucial if you want to stay on fish...."

Burning the Banks | The Ultimate Bass Fishing Resource Guide® LLC
Burning the Banks | The Ultimate Bass Fishing Resource Guide® LLC: "Any one who knows me will tell you that I'm crazy about jerkbaits. I will throw them until my arm gives out. I truly believe that I have wasted many years of bass fishing by not throwing these baits, especially in clear water. It's amazing how far a bass will travel to smash a wild moving jerkbait. Give me a big flat with lots of submerged grass and I am happy."

Bass Fishing Tip: Go Slow for Spring Largemouth | Field & Stream
Bass Fishing Tip: Go Slow for Spring Largemouth | Field & Stream: "In early spring, bass move onto reservoir flats to warm up prior to spawning. They’re sluggish in cold water, so they’ll often ignore a fast-moving crankbait or a bulky spinnerbait. But a jig that is swimming like a slow-moving baitfish is an offer they often can’t refuse. A weedless, 1⁄8- to 3⁄8-ounce jig in black, brown, or green pumpkin works best with this horizontal presentation. Tip the hook with a matching pork or plastic chunk trailer to add a realistic fluttering action. Fish the combo on a 7-foot, medium-heavy spinning or baitcasting outfit with 8- to 12-pound fluorocarbon."

Get Out the Plastic | The Ultimate Bass Fishing Resource Guide® LLC
Get Out the Plastic | The Ultimate Bass Fishing Resource Guide® LLC: "Unlimited fishing potential. Minimal startup investment. Outstanding exercise benefits. No maintenance fees.
Too good to be true?
Kayak fishing is a lot like powerboat fishing, minus the repairs, storage fees, fuel, insurance and weekend launch ramp chaos. Kayaks offer an inexpensive entry to anglers getting on the water for the first time, as well as the perfect exit strategy for boaters trying to downsize. Solitude, self-reliance and a good workout come at no extra charge."

Ice Fisherman Catches 32-pound Common Carp, Possible Record | OutdoorHub
Ice Fisherman Catches 32-pound Common Carp, Possible Record | OutdoorHub: "Andrew Plumridge, 41, landed a possible world-record catch-and-release common carp on his second-ever ice fishing trip. The massive 32-pound, two-ounce fish was Plumridge’s first catch on rod and reel. The Sharon, Massachusetts bank auditor was part of a group fishing the Housatonic River on January 31. The group was guided by former professional angler Paul Tawczynski, who said the fish was the biggest carp he had ever pulled out of water in his career."
